Youth Garden Grants
In 1982, we saw the need to reconnect kids to their food and began our Youth Garden Grant program. The concept was simple: provide much-needed funds and materials to school and youth groups to jumpstart or enhance their garden programs. We knew the positive impact that gardening had on youth and were determined to make gardens accessible for all. Program Goals – Use gardening with youth as a means to develop science, work and life skills. 1) Establish gardening programs for youth in the four target counties. 2) Use gardening as a means to:. A learn about food production, growing plants and nutrition. B develop an appreciation for science and nature. C reinforce science and math concepts.
